Dred Scott an enslaved Black man, sued for his freedom in 1846. Scott claimed that living in free states and territories made him a free man.The Supreme Court ruled against Scott, stating that Black people could not be citizens and could not sue in federal court.The decision also invalidated the Missouri Compromise, which attempted to balance the number of free and slave states.
